Full CASCO or Partial CASCO?

When choosing CASCO insurance, one of the most common questions drivers ask is the difference between full CASCO and partial CASCO. Both insurance options are designed to protect the vehicle against certain risks, but their coverage scope, price, and practical value can be very different.

\n\n

Many vehicle owners make a decision based only on price. However, when choosing CASCO, the real question should not be “which option is cheaper?” but rather “which option is more suitable for my vehicle and my risks?” A cheaper package may not provide sufficient protection when an actual insured event occurs.

\n\n

What is full CASCO?

\n\n

Full CASCO is an insurance package that provides broader protection for the vehicle. It usually covers traffic accidents, theft, fire, natural disasters, unlawful actions by third parties, vandalism, and several additional risks depending on the policy terms.

\n\n

Full CASCO is especially recommended for new, expensive, financed, and actively used vehicles. In such cases, the potential financial loss can be high, and limited coverage may not be enough to protect the vehicle owner from serious expenses.

\n\n

What is partial CASCO?

\n\n

Partial CASCO is a more limited insurance package that covers only selected risks. It may also be offered as mini CASCO or limited CASCO coverage. The main purpose is to provide protection against specific risks while keeping the insurance premium lower.

\n\n

For example, a partial CASCO package may cover only accident damage, only theft, or only certain types of loss. That is why it is important to carefully check which risks are included and which situations are excluded from the policy.

\n\n

The main difference is the scope of coverage

\n\n

The key difference between full CASCO and partial CASCO is the breadth of coverage. Full CASCO protects against a wider range of risks. Partial CASCO provides limited protection only for selected risks.

\n\n

This difference becomes especially clear when a real incident happens. For example, if the car is damaged while parked, affected by a natural event, or damaged due to the actions of a third party, such cases may not be covered under a partial package. Full CASCO, due to its wider coverage, may be much more useful in these situations.

\n\n

Why is there a price difference?

\n\n

Full CASCO is usually more expensive than partial CASCO. The main reason is that the insurance company assumes more risks under a full package. As the coverage becomes broader, the insurance premium also increases accordingly.

\n\n

Partial CASCO may be cheaper because the insurer’s responsibility is more limited. However, a lower price does not always mean a better choice. If the risk you actually need is not included in the package, you may have to cover the damage yourself.

\n\n

Who should choose full CASCO?

\n\n

Full CASCO is more suitable for owners of new vehicles, expensive cars, financed vehicles, and drivers who use their cars daily. For these drivers, vehicle damage can create a serious financial burden.

\n\n

It may also be the better choice if the car is parked outdoors, driven frequently in heavy city traffic, or if the owner wants maximum protection and peace of mind.

\n\n

Who may find partial CASCO sufficient?

\n\n

Partial CASCO may be suitable for drivers who want to manage their budget, whose vehicle has a lower market value, or who only want protection against specific risks.

\n\n

For example, if the driver is mainly concerned about theft and does not need wider coverage for other risks, partial CASCO may be a reasonable option. However, proper risk assessment is essential before making this choice.

\n\n

What should you check before choosing?

\n\n

When choosing CASCO, it is not enough to look only at the package name. Full and partial CASCO terms may differ from one insurance company to another. Therefore, covered risks, exclusions, deductible amount, repair service conditions, and claim payment rules should be reviewed carefully.

\n\n

The most important question is: “Does this package cover my real risks?” If the answer is yes, the package may be suitable. If important risks are left outside the coverage, choosing a broader package may be the safer decision.

\n\n

Final conclusion

\n\n

Full CASCO offers broader and more reliable protection, while partial CASCO is a more limited but more affordable alternative. The right choice depends on the vehicle’s value, usage pattern, driver’s risk level, and budget.
